Narrabri Airport (NAA), also known by its ICAO code YNBR, serves as a vital aviation gateway to the Narrabri region of New South Wales, Australia. While not a major international hub, it plays a crucial role in connecting this part of rural New South Wales to larger cities and regional centres.
Located a short distance from the Narrabri town centre, the airport is easily accessible. The journey from the centre of Narrabri to the airport is typically a quick drive, taking approximately 5-10 minutes by car. Public transport options are more limited, so planning ahead is recommended.
As a regional airport, Narrabri Airport primarily facilitates domestic flights within Australia. While passenger traffic isn't as high as major metropolitan airports, it's an important link for business travellers, residents, and tourists visiting the Narrabri region. It provides essential connectivity for this part of New South Wales.
Narrabri Airport is a smaller regional airport, and as such, it operates with a single terminal building. This simplifies navigation and ensures a straightforward experience for passengers.
The single terminal at Narrabri Airport handles all arriving and departing flights. Within the terminal, you'll find check-in counters, a security screening area, and a departure lounge. Baggage claim is also located within the terminal, making for a quick and easy process upon arrival.
Given the airport's size, inter-terminal transport isn't a concern. Everything is conveniently located within easy walking distance inside the single terminal building.
Narrabri Airport primarily caters to domestic airlines that connect Narrabri with other regional centres and major cities within New South Wales and potentially beyond. These airlines provide essential links for both business and leisure travel.
Popular routes from Narrabri Airport typically include flights to Sydney and other key destinations within New South Wales. These routes are crucial for connecting the Narrabri region to broader networks, facilitating onward travel and supporting the local economy. Seasonal flights may operate depending on demand and specific events in the region.

While Narrabri Airport is primarily a regional airport, there are still options for accommodation and things to do nearby. If you have a layover or are planning to explore the area, here's a quick guide:
For closest hotels, you'll find options in Narrabri itself, which is a short drive from the airport. Look for hotels or motels in the town centre for easy access to amenities and restaurants. Some hotels might offer airport shuttle services, so it's worth checking when you book. Areas like Wee Waa, a short drive from Narrabri, may also offer accommodation options.
If you have some time to spare, consider visiting these tourist attractions near Narrabri: The Narrabri Observatory, a great spot for stargazing; the Yarrie Lake, perfect for water sports and picnics; the Sawn Rocks, a unique geological formation; the Narrabri Historical Museum, to learn about the region's past; and the Pilliga Forest, offering bushwalking and wildlife spotting opportunities. These spots provide a taste of the natural beauty and history of the Narrabri region.
